UML之概述、結構三要素、面向物件技術
Unified Modeling Language (UML)又稱統一建模語言或標準建模語言,它是一個支援模型化和軟體系統開發的圖形化語言,為軟體開發的所有階段提供模型化和視覺化支援,包括由需求分析到規格,到構造和配置。
UML是面向物件軟體的標準化建模語言。
梳理導圖如下:
UML由3個要素構成:UML的基本構造塊、支配這些構造塊如何放置在一起的規則和運用於整個語言的公用機制。
UML有3種基本的構造塊:事物、關係和圖。
梳理導圖如下:
面向物件技術導圖梳理:
通過以上梳理僅清晰了UML是面向物件的統一建模語言,並對UML的各個階段建模內容有了巨集觀的瞭解,具體的每個圖處於哪個階段如何繪製還需要再細化研究,下一站用例檢視^_^
相關推薦
UML之概述、結構三要素、面向物件技術
Unified Modeling Language (UML)又稱統一建模語言或標準建模語言,它是一個支援模型化和軟體系統開發的圖形化語言,為軟體開發的所有階段提供模型化和視覺化支援,包括由需求分析到規格,到構造和配置。 UML是面向物件軟體的標準化建模語言。 梳理導圖如下:
3億人都在用的拼多多贏在哪?人、貨、場三要素全面勝出
基本 基礎上 世界 銷售 一次 美國 政府 -- 淘寶 6月30日,拼多多向美國證券交易委員會(SEC)正式提交了招股說明書。回想僅僅3年前的這個時候,拼多多這個名字還默默無聞。誰能想到今天的它已經是擁有近3億用戶、月GMV在30億以上的龐然大物。作為一個電商平臺,從創立到
UML之行為圖(活動圖、狀態圖、序列圖、協作圖)
一、活動圖 1、什麼是活動圖 活動圖和流程圖十分類似,表示一個演算法的執行序列、過程、判定點、分支和迴圈,而且活動圖支援並行活動(同步條的作用)。在實際專案中,活動圖並不是
UMl之靜態圖(類圖、物件圖、包圖)
一、類圖 類是具有相似結構、行為和關係的一組物件的描述符。類圖是用於定義系統中的類,包括描述類的內部結構和類的關係。類圖主要用於描述系統的靜態結構。 如何尋找類: 在待開發系統中尋找
資料庫-資料模型(分類、三要素、概念)
(1)資料模型的分類: 最常用的資料模型是概念資料模型和結構資料模型: ①概念資料模型(資訊模型):面向使用者的,按照使用者的觀點進行建模,典型代表:E-R圖 ②結構資料模型:面向計算機系
UML之行為圖(活動圖、狀態圖、互動圖)
UML的行為圖是用來描述系統的動態模型和物件之間的互動關係,包括三種:活動圖、狀態圖、互動圖。 下面對這三種圖進行介紹: 一、活動圖: 1、定義:用來描述滿足
AE二次開發中幾個功能速成歸納(符號設計器、創建要素、圖形編輯、屬性表編輯、緩沖區分析)
文件夾路徑 及其 基本框架 option 開啟 rgs database ets remove /* * 實習課上講進階功能所用文檔,因為趕時間從網上抄抄改改,湊合能用,記錄一下以備個人後用。 * * --------------------------------
shell腳本介紹、結構和執行、date命令用法、shell腳本中的變量
出現 用法 日期 腳本語言 通過 idle ali 日歷 實現 shell 腳本介紹 shell 是一種腳本語言 shell有自己的語法,可以使用邏輯判斷、循環等語法 可以自定義函數,目的就是為了減少重復的代碼 shell 是系統命令的集合 shell 腳
Python基礎(三)--- Python面向物件oop,類、方法和變數,繼承
一、面向物件oop ----------------------------------------------------- 1.類 用來描述具有相同的屬性和方法的物件的集合。 它定義了該集合中每個物件所共有的屬性和方法。 物件是類的例項。
【軟考】——面向物件技術(互動圖、構件圖、組合結構圖、協作圖、部署圖、包圖)
互動圖???——》對系統的動態方面進行建模; 互動圖組成???——》物件、訊息、生命線等; 互動圖表現???——》序列圖、通訊圖、互動概覽圖、計時圖、狀態圖; 順序圖主要元素
流式資料、批式資料、實時資料、歷史資料、結構化資料、非結構化資料
大資料處理系統可分為批式(batch)大資料和流式(streaming)大資料兩類。其中,批式大資料又被稱為歷史大資料,流式大資料又被稱為實時大資料。 流資料是一組順序、大量、快速、連續到達的資料序列,一般情況下,資料流可被視為一個隨時間延續而無限增長的動態資料集合。應用於網路
結構體變數、結構指標變數、結構陣列作為函式的引數應用例項分析 .
結構體變數、結構指標變數、結構陣列作為函式的引數應用例項分析 struct stud { long int num; float score; }; /*結構體變數作為函式的引數,修改之後的成員值不能返回到主調函式*/ void funvr(struct stud t) { t.num=200010
結構體定義、結構體指標、記憶體分配、指標、結構體形參的深入理解
說明:此程式為深入學習資料結構時候,對於資料結構最重要的基礎(結構體、指標、記憶體分配) 方面的一些理解,我自己通過這段程式說明一些自己得到的結論;希望對看到這篇程式的c愛好者 有幫助,如果有理解錯誤的地方希望各位聯絡我,一起討論學習.說實話,我學習c就半年吧,除了 上課自學的,發現最難的部分就是指標了.廢話
資料庫-第一正規化、第二正規化、第三正規化、BC正規化、第四正規化簡析
在設計與操作維護資料庫時,最關鍵的問題就是要確保資料能夠正確地分佈到資料庫的表中。使用正確的資料結構,不僅有助於對資料庫進行相應的存取操作,還可以極大地簡化應用程式中的其他內容(查詢、窗體、報表、程式碼等),按照“資料庫規範化”對錶進行設計,其目的就是減少資料庫中的資料冗餘
資料庫的正規化:第一正規化、第二正規化、第三正規化、BC正規化、第四正規化
簡介 資料庫正規化在資料庫設計中的地位一直很曖昧,教科書中對於資料庫正規化倒是都給出了學術性的定義,但實際應用中正規化的應用卻不甚樂觀,這篇文章會用簡單的語言和一個簡單的資料庫DEMO將一個不符合正規化的資料庫一步步從第一正規化實現到第四正規化。 關
設計模式分類(建立型模式、結構型模式、行為模式)
1.建立型模式前面講過,社會化的分工越來越細,自然在軟體設計方面也是如此,因此物件的建立和物件的使用分開也就成為了必然趨勢。因為物件的建立會消耗掉系統的很多資源,所以單獨對物件的建立進行研究,從而能夠高效地建立物件就是建立型模式要探討的問題。這裡有6個具體的建立型模式可供研究
包機制、訪問修飾符、Jar包 java初學 面向物件五
包機制 問題:當定義了多個類的時候,可能會發生類名的重複問題。 在java中採用包機制處理開發者定義的類名衝突問題。 怎麼使用java的包機制呢? 使用package 關鍵字。 package 包名。 問題: javac PackDemo1.java編譯沒有問題
UML與面向物件技術基礎
UML 採用面向物件技術設計系統,從應用的角度看,首先是描述需求,其次根據需求建立系統的靜態模型,以構造系統的結構;最後描述系統的行為。UML的主要內容可以歸納為靜態建模機制和動態建模兩大類。 面向物件技術設計系統 UML圖
三道關於面向物件設計的面試題
題一 Imagine you have a call center with three levels of employees: fresher, technical lead (TL), product manager (PM). There can be multip
好書整理系列之-設計模式:可複用面向物件軟體的基礎 4
第4章結構型模式結構型模式涉及到如何組合類和物件以獲得更大的結構。結構型類模式採用繼承機制來組合介面或實現。一個簡單的例子是採用多重繼承方法將兩個以上的類組合成一個類,結果這個類包含了所有父類的性質。這一模式尤其有助於多個獨立開發的類庫協同工作。另外一個例子是類形式的A d